Where is the Samsung TV Power Cord Location?

Samsung TV power cord location is often be overlooked amidst the excitement of connecting all your devices. Typically, you’ll find the power cord positioned at the back of the television, cleverly integrated into the design to maintain a sleek profile. However, the exact placement can vary by model some newer versions feature a detachable power cable that runs through a discreet channel, allowing for a cleaner look and easier cable management.

Understanding Samsung TV power cord location helps in the initial setup. When you’re mounting your TV on the wall, knowing this location helps in planning your cable routes effectively, ensuring minimal visibility of wires.

Locating Power Cords on Samsung The Frame TV Series

The Samsung The Frame TV Series: This is a stunning blend of art and technology, and its design reflects that ethos even in the placement of power cords. Unlike traditional models, The Frame often utilizes a nearly invisible One Connect Box that houses the power supply and other connections. Users can position the TV closer to the wall while hiding the cords away, enhancing the overall visual appeal.

Troubleshooting Samsung TV Power Issues

When troubleshooting power issues with your Samsung TV, the overlooked factor is the Samsung TV power cord location. It’s easy to assume that a malfunctioning TV is the root cause, but a frayed or pinched power cord can disrupt the flow of electricity. Consider examining the entire length of the cord for any signs of damage, particularly in high traffic areas where it may be subjected to constant bending or pressure.

Plugging your TV into a different socket can help determine if the issue lies with the original outlet. If you find that multiple devices fail to work in that outlet, it may be time to call an electrician. Furthermore, utilizing a surge protector can safeguard your equipment from power surges while also providing additional outlets, which can reduce clutter and improve airflow around your devices factors that might otherwise contribute to overheating and power failure.

Samsung TV Power Cord Safety and Maintenance

It is crucial not for powering your device and also for maintaining a safe environment in your home. Regularly inspect the cord for any signs of wear, fraying, or damage, as these can lead to short circuits or even fire hazards. Keeping the cord free from obstructions and away from high traffic areas minimizes the risk of tripping or accidental unplugging.

Another vital aspect of power cord maintenance involves proper storage and management. When not in use, coiling the cord neatly and securing it away from heat sources can prevent degradation over time. Additionally, using cord organizers or clips can help keep your setup tidy and reduce stress on the connectors.
